Dr. Ryan Sod Joins First State Health & Wellness

October 25, 2021

Dr. Ryan Sod, Chiropractic Physician, has joined the team at First State Health & Wellness in Rehoboth Beach.

Dr. Sod, a graduate of Palmer College of Chiropractic, integrates chiropractic care with rehabilitation services for optimal pain relief and healing without drugs or surgery. “My chiropractic education and clinical experience have prepared me to provide our community with the most effective and efficient evidence-based clinical practice,” he says. “My goal as a clinician is to implement chiropractic adjustments, soft tissue mobilizations, and acupuncture in order to allow for greater utilization of rehabilitative exercises. I will strive to empower you, the patient, to take an active role in your care plan by teaching you what can be done in and outside of our clinic in order to help you get well and stay well.”

Dr. Stacy Cohen, along with his wife and business partner Dr. Lydia Cohen, founded First State Health & Wellness in 1984. “Dr. Sod truly exemplifies the virtues of compassion, leadership, commitment and passion for the chiropractic profession,” says Dr. Stacy Cohen. “We are thrilled that he chose to join First State Health & Wellness and he will be a dynamic addition to the team caring for our beach communities.”
